To build the webpage, install Docker and build the docker image with the following instructions
docker build -f ./docker/Dockerfile.webpage -t wildfenicswebpagebuilder .and then build the webpage with:
docker run -ti -v $(pwd):/root/shared -w /root/shared --rm --shm-size=512m wildfenicswebpagebuilderdocker run -ti -v $(pwd):/root/shared -w /root/shared --rm --shm-size=512m wildfenicswebpagebuilder
The webpage is then build in _build/html/index.html.
